This License Plate Is Going Viral for Surprising Reason!

A license plate in Perth has gone viral for its clever disguise, sparking a social media sensation. The driver’s tactic to evade detection by Western Australia’s transport officials adds intrigue, especially considering nearly 1,000 personalized plates were rejected last year for offensive content.

Plates like SAUC3D and RAMP4GE were denied for hinting at inappropriate or illicit activities. Personalized plates are more popular among men, but not all applications survive the review process. Somehow, this plate slipped through unnoticed.

This incident highlights social media’s power to turn ordinary moments into viral hits, celebrating creativity and humor in unexpected ways. Whether intentional or not, the driver behind the plate has made a lasting impression online.
